A Journey Through Time: The Ancient Ruins of Olympia

As a former professor of European history, I have always been drawn to the ancient ruins that whisper tales of bygone eras. My recent journey to Katakolo, Greece, was no exception. The allure of exploring the birthplace of the Olympic Games and indulging in the rich flavors of local olive oil was irresistible. The Olympia Tour promised an intimate experience, away from the throngs of tourists, and it delivered in spades.

Our adventure began at the Katakolo Port, where we were greeted by our amiable driver, Kostia. The small group setting was a refreshing change from the usual crowded tours. As we drove through the lush Greek countryside, I couldn’t help but reflect on the historical significance of our destination. Olympia, once a sanctuary dedicated to Zeus, was a place where athletes from across the ancient world gathered to compete in the sacred games. The anticipation of walking the same grounds where history was made was palpable.

The Sacred Grounds of Olympia

Upon arrival, we were whisked past the long lines, thanks to our pre-arranged tickets. Our guide, Elana, a certified expert by the Greek Ministry of Tourism, was a treasure trove of knowledge. Her passion for history was infectious as she led us through the archaeological site. We stood in awe at the Temple of Zeus, imagining the grandeur of the statue that once stood as one of the Seven Wonders of the Ancient World.

Elana’s detailed narratives brought the ruins to life. She painted vivid pictures of the ancient athletes, their training regimens, and the cultural significance of the games. As we walked the ancient track, I could almost hear the echoes of the cheering crowds from millennia past. It was a humbling experience, a reminder of the enduring legacy of human achievement and the timeless pursuit of excellence.
